With a handful of monsters still eluding players but some Pokémon is rarer than others. These celebrated and rare creatures are said to be in the game, despite no one having discovered them in the wild yet. According to a chart compiled by enthusiasts on Reddit, the top six toughest finds in Pokémon Go are Ditto, and Mew, Mewtwo, Moltres, Zapdos, Articuno. No one has seen these Pokémon thus far in-game, leading many to wonder if they are even obtainable through natural methods. A fanatic who shared what he said is Pokémon Go's code found data files for each of the six Pokémon now missing in action, however, indicating they're available within the game.

Even better, or worse, determined by how you take it, the game encourages exercise. To hatch eggs you find, you must walk a set distance. The farther the distance, the rarer the Pokemon! The game even offers a means to game without constantly checking your device. It's possible for you to get the Pokemon Go Plus unit, which can be worn on the wrist, and connects via Bluetooth to your apparatus to notify you of in-game events, like sightings, using a LED light and vibrations. So why are these monsters so rare? Most of this list checks out; in the Pokémon games, each renowned bird, and Mewtwo are just located in particular locations, while Mew is historically one of the hardest monsters to locate and capture. As for Ditto, nevertheless, although the Ordinary-kind isn't classified as a mythical, it can be tough to find in many of the traditional games. That is due in part to its abilities that are breeding that are distinctive; the Pokémon breed and can mimic with virtually any other to reproduce Pokémon. As for where to find them, it is still impossible to say.
